First Help Fundamentals: Must-Have Family Products for Every Home

Every household should be equipped with particular emergency treatment products to take care of common emergency situations properly. Below is a categorized checklist of must-have essentials:

Essential Emergency treatment Supplies

Adhesive Bandages
    For minor cuts and abrasions.
Sterile Gauze Pads
    Ideal for covering larger wounds.
Antiseptic Wipes
    Helps in cleaning injuries to prevent infection.
Medical Tape
    Useful for protecting gauze pads.
Tweezers
    Perfect for removing splinters or ticks.
Scissors
    Essential for reducing tape, gauze, or apparel if needed.
Instant Cold Packs
    Reduces swelling and numbs pain instantly.
Elastic Bandages
    Great for covering strains or strains.
Thermometer
    Helps monitor body temperature level throughout fever.
Burn Lotion or Gel
    Provides remedy for minor burns.

Medication Essentials

Pain Relievers (like Advil or Acetaminophen)
    Effective for minimizing discomfort and inflammation.
Allergy Medicine (Antihistamines)
    Vital for sensitive reactions.
Hydrocortisone Cream
    Useful for insect attacks and rashes.
Aspirin
    Often made use of during suspected heart attacks (adhering to medical advice).

Tools and Equipment

CPR Face Guard or Mask
    Protects throughout mouth-to-mouth resuscitation.
First Aid Handbook or Guidebook
    A handy recommendation that offers guidelines in emergencies.
Emergency Covering (Room Covering)
    Retains body heat in case of shock or chilly exposure.
Flashlight & Bonus Batteries
    Essential throughout power outages and emergency situations at night.
Portable First Aid Kit
    For getaways or travel; guarantees you're constantly prepared away from home.

Dealing with Usual Injuries at Home

From cuts to sprains, recognizing exactly how to deal with usual injuries can dramatically reduce healing time and improve outcomes.

image

Kitchen Knife Cuts

Kitchen knife cuts prevail but frequently convenient if treated correctly:

image

Wash the injury gently with soap and water. Apply antibacterial wipes to sanitize the area. Use clean and sterile gauze pads to cover the cut; apply pressure if hemorrhaging persists.
